It's all a little awkward. Sir Keir Starmer is set to deliver his defence spending proposals to NATO next month, despite having lost both his job and his defence secretary.
But the outgoing PM seems determined to push through with his plans just days before Andy Burnham potentially moves into Downing Street.
The man whose resignation helped hasten Starmer's departure - ex-defence secretary John Healey - recently held talks with Burnham.
But what do we know about our expected new prime minister's position on military spending? Will he prove to be more of a hawk or a dove when it comes to the defence of the realm?
Niall is joined by Sky’s political correspondent Rob Powell and military analyst Sean Bell.
